Mr. Andreas Loutsios holds the position of Vice Chairman of the Cyprus Computer Science Society (CCS) Board and he has been an active member of the Society since 1988. Over time, he has substantially contributed to the promotion of IT in Cyprus, actively participating in the actions, events, conferences and competitions organized by CCS. At the same time, he represents the Society in collaborations with Educational Institutions, in European Projects and in International Organizations. Since 1983, he has served IT in various positions, working in organizations such as the Department of Information Technology of the Government and the Central Bank of Cyprus. His particular professional interest is Systems and Information Security and IT Systems Audit. At the academic level, he holds a BSc in Physics, MSc in Computer Science and a Master in Business Administration (MBA). He is a member of ISACA (Information Systems Audit and Control Association) and holds the professional qualifications CISA (Certified Information Systems Auditor) and CGEIT (Certified in the Governance of Enterprise IT). He is also an ISACA Accredited Trainer. Furthermore, in the context of lifelong learning, he has attended numerous professional trainings and seminars both in Cyprus and abroad.

Dr. Panicos Masouras holds the post of Assistant Professor in the Department of Nursing, School of Health Sciences at the Cyprus University of Technology. He also served as Lecturer and Senior Lecturer at the Higher Technical Institute. He is the CCS Board Secretary and within his duties as projects coordinator he established and manages the annual events of BEBRAS, ROBOTEX, Cyprus Cyber Security Challenge and Coding Our Future.

Ms. Skevi Skordallou got a bachelor’s degree in Information Systems from Middle Tennessee State University, USA. Skevi worked in IT for 30 years, started working in the private sector and Offshore companies as Systems Analyst/Programmer. Skevi then moved on to the Airline business where she worked as ICT Officer contributing to the organization automation and deployment of large scale systems. In 2015, following her practice of continuous education, she got a certification in ICT auditing (CISA) from ISACA and she has been working since as a consultant in ICT auditing.
Ms. Skordallou has been a member of CCS since 24 November 1994 and has been elected/re-elected on several occasion and serves as a CCS board treasurer. She contributes to the organization of events and the promotion of Information Technology targeting women participation and diversity.

Yiannos Aletraris received his BSc and MSc degrees in Computer Science from the University of Manchester, and later on received diplomas in Management and Leadership from the Henley Business School and the CIIM, as well as an advanced diploma from the International Compliance Association. He worked in the IT area for 20 years, initially at the Cyprus Popular Bank, and then the Central Bank of Cyprus where he moved, for the last 12 years in the area of Organisation and Planning. He has been a member of the CCS since 1989, and from 1991 onwards he has served on different positions in the Board. He worked a number of years on the Society’s publications and organising Conferences and training seminars.

George Christodoulou is the Managing Director of ZEBRA Consultants, one of the leading Information Technology companies in Cyprus specializing in software development, infrastructure solutions, consulting services, systems integration and cloud solutions. With more than 20 years of experience in the ICT sector, George helps organizations shape their digital transformation strategy using innovative technology solutions. He holds a BSc in Business Information Technology and an MSc in Information Management. With numerous technical and project management competencies and certifications, he has been involved in the successful delivery of complex IT projects in Cyprus, Greece and the Middle East. Since 2011 George is a board member of the Cyprus Computer Society contributing in the increase of awareness of ICT in Cyprus promoting at the same time high standards among IT professionals.

George Michael is a researcher at KIOS Research and Innovation Centre of Excellence at the University of Cyprus. He received a B.Sc. and an M.Sc. in Computer Science from the University of Cyprus and he is pursuing a Ph.D. in Computer Engineering. He worked at the Data-Driven Multi-threading Laboratory at the University of Cyprus for a few years doing research on high-performance computing. Following, he worked as a software developer at XM.COM and CeraNext LTD. His work is mostly on GNU/Linux systems. He is an active Cyprus Computer Society (CCS) and IEEE volunteer and he held various positions during the past few years. Between them: member of the board of Cyprus Computer Society (CCS) / Cyprus Informatics Olympiad Committee / Robotex Competition Scientific Committee / the University of Cyprus IEEE Student Branch / IEEE Cyprus Section Executive Committee / IEEE Region 8 Committee / IEEE Day / IEEEXtreme
